Klappentext zu „Do Unto Animals: A Friendly Guide to How Animals Live, and How We Can Make Their Lives Better “
Tracey Stewart is on a mission to change how we interact with animals. From the time she was a little girl, she considered animals her friends and her saviors. In her mid-twenties, she became a veterinary tech and later a passionate advocate for the nonprofit Animal Haven. When the kids came along, she worked with animals to teach her family about responsibility and the deep satisfaction that comes from giving back. And most recently, the entire Stewart clan has decamped to a farm in New Jersey to operate an affiliate of Farm Sanctuary, a place that provides a permanent, happy home to rescued farm animals. And so this book. Through hundreds of charming illustrations, a few homemade projects, and with a quirky, knowledgeable voice, Stewart provides insight into the secret lives of animals, information about the kindest ways to live with them, and what we can do for them in return. At home, she shows how to speak "dog-ese¿ and ¿cat-ease,¿ why mutts are the most worthwhile companions, and how to "virtually adopt¿ an animal. In the backyard, we learn about building a bee house, dealing nicely with pesky moles, and finding creative ways to bird watch. And at the farm, Stewart teaches us everything from the specific (all about a pig's superpowers) to the general (what we can do to help all farm animals lead a better life). Part practical guide, part memoir of her life with animals, and part testament to the power of giving back, A Friendly Guide to the Animals Around Us is a gift for those who know that the better our interactions with animals are, the better our own lives will be.
